Mail Digests of System Log Files to the System Administrator
Logdigest, run by cron at night, greps through system log files
(var/log/messages, /var/log/mail, etc.) to find "interesting" content.
Lines matching the regular expressions in /etc/logdigest are simply
ignored. More expressions can be added to /etc/logdigest/ignore.local.
See /etc/logdigest/config for some general settings.
The results are mailed to the sysadmin daily.
